YouTube Studio is the official tool to edit and coordinate your video content published on the platform. Use this tool to edit your video, blur sections, add automatic subtitles, manage playlists, monitor your analytics, access the royalty-free music and sound library, plus respond to comments. It’s worth noting that the editing tools on offer are not advanced, but they are effective for simple tasks such as trimming. The software is easily accessible within YouTube and available for Windows, Mac, and Android. If you are looking to work directly from your Android phone, this is the best YouTube video editor for Android and can be downloaded from the Google Play online store.

Blender is a free, open-source, cross-platform 3D creation suite that offers support and tools for everything from a 3D pipeline, modeling, animation, and motion tracking to video editing and game creation. It doesn’t have a very user-friendly interface, and it will take some time to master all the features, but once you are ready, you will find it’s the best video editor for YouTube gaming. The suite is widely appreciated by gamers and developers and has strong community support. Additionally, as open-source software, it’s constantly being developed and updated.

Shotcut is a free, open-source, cross-platform video-editing software program. The video effects are comprehensive and include advanced features such as chroma key, 360° filters, 3-way color wheels for color correction, speed effects, and more. The full suite of video-editing tools allows you to make both simple edits and more complex changes to produce quality videos. It also offers an impressive range of audio functions such as scopes, filters, mixing abilities, fades, and transitions. As an open-source program, there are regular updates and improvements, with open-source developers able to contribute. While there is a built-in audio library, you can also import your own music choices to the program.

DaVinci Resolve is a free professional-grade, comprehensive post-production software program. PC and Mac compatible, it offers powerful tools for video editing, color correction and tracking, mixing audio, and visual effects. There is a high level of customization possible too, for more advanced video makers. The interface and integrated workflow are user-friendly but mastering all available features might take time if you are an absolute beginner. However, once you get on top of things, this feature-rich video-editing software will help you produce high-quality creative projects. While it’s recognized by industry professionals for its technical quality and film effects features, it’s also adapted for smaller video projects and clips. The handy export tool will guide you through the correct file formats to upload to YouTube and other online platforms.

Summary

To find the best video editor for YouTube for your video content projects, first, identify your needs and priorities. What is key to your successful creation of engaging, professional-quality videos that clearly share your message and your creative vision? When making your decision, consider the importance of the following points.

  • User-friendly interface: do you need to be guided through software or do you already have experience in video editing and feel confident in navigating it regardless of the interface?
  • Features, effects, tools available: what features are the most essential to your project? Do you need a complete suite of editing tools or just wish to make a few trims? Do you want to have the choice of adding filters, masks, transitions, audio, images, graphics, etc.?
  • Price: do you prefer a free software solution? Some software options have a free trial and then a compulsory upgrade to the paid version. Paid doesn’t always equal better. Sometimes the best video editor for YouTube is a free option.
  • Online or downloadable: would an online tool suit your technical requirements better? This would save space on your hard drive and allow you to store your video files in the cloud, with access from anywhere, anytime. A downloadable version means you don’t have to rely on a stable Internet connection, and you can store and share your projects however you like.
  • Customer support: do you want to be able to speak to customer support directly or can you manage with user guides and tutorials? What if you have a technical issue you can’t solve?
